A family story of Brazil, just at the time when Brazil achieved independence of Portugal -- a story that has caught the flavor of the place, and yet managed to make the children of the story very real and undated. You get glimpses of the home atmosphere, of the friendly priest to whom the children make their small confession, of the drastic steps little Maria Luiza takes to get a baby sister, and of her devotion when the baby sister came. Then there are scenes in the market, the puppet show, the procession of Saint Anthony, the battle of the lemons.
